Adam and his wife Erica struggled with infertility for fifteen months. Adam did not anticipate having to go through testing himself when they weren't getting pregnant. It became harder and harder with each month and they were planning their days around ovulation. They decided to keep the struggles to themselves because they did not want to add the extra pressure of the parents and others getting all excited about being grandparents and having to share the disappointment every month.  He said later we realized that it was toxic to keep it just between the 2 of us because we had no one to give us support or perspective.

Erica was given clomid to try, which gave them new hope that they would become pregnant.  On their 5th and final round of clomid when Adam was thinking this may not happen for us,  he was starting to research about IVF and adoption when Erica surprised him with a positive pregnancy test. On a routine ultrasound it was discovered that the baby had something that looked suspicious and it could be cancerous. At 37 weeks with the area growing their baby girl was delivered.

We talked about the things people say that trigger very hurtful emotions, where they found support and the journey of their baby being treated for cancer.

Adams words of advice and encouragement: You are a dad, father and family man and let that be your identity versus something else, especially for those that have spent so much time to have a family.  If you need to see a specialist don't wait too long because your frustration level will go up while getting educated and talking with doctors. Trust your medical professional and if you don't feel confident with them find someone else. Avoid the internet searching because you could find things that you may not need to focus on at the time you need it. Don't go down that rabbit hole because it can put a lot of pressure on you.
